Output 38238659d314d390ea53db0e35339c9eecb0c5c056ebd02d2ed99c49fc758475:0

value
36572250
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 215407006ba2dfe22da547f8f8f3737b47474c14 OP_EQUALVERIFY OP_CHECKSIG
address
143Dxesr7kLPyq8oCTVszZeMmsT4sfdoub
transaction
38238659d314d390ea53db0e35339c9eecb0c5c056ebd02d2ed99c49fc758475
spent
true